Submersible Water Pumps in Tanzania
Submersible Water Pumps in Tanzania are very important for both homes and farms. These pumps work while placed under water, making them very efficient and long-lasting. People use them to draw water from boreholes, rivers, lakes, or storage tanks. They are very helpful in Tanzania because water access is a big need for farming and home use.
How Submersible Water Pumps Work
A submersible pump works by pushing water to the surface instead of pulling. Since it stays under water, it uses less energy compared to surface pumps. The motor is sealed so water does not enter, making it safe to use under water.
Types of Submersible Water Pumps in Tanzania
There are many types of Submersible Water Pumps in Tanzania. Each type is designed for a special use:
-
Borehole Submersible Pumps – These are used to draw water from deep wells and boreholes.
-
Sewage Submersible Pumps – They are designed to handle dirty water and waste.
-
Drainage Submersible Pumps – Useful for removing floodwater or excess water from construction sites.
-
Irrigation Submersible Pumps – Farmers use these to pump water for crops.
-
Domestic Submersible Pumps – These are smaller pumps used for homes and small gardens.

Prices of Submersible Water Pumps in Tanzania
The cost of Submersible Water Pumps in Tanzania depends on brand, depth, and motor size. Below is a price guide:
| Pump Type | Brand | Power (HP) | Price Range (TZS) |
|---|---|---|---|
| Borehole Pump | Grundfos | 1.5 HP | 1,200,000 – 2,500,000 |
| Borehole Pump | Pedrollo | 1 HP | 900,000 – 1,800,000 |
| Irrigation Pump | Varuna | 2 HP | 700,000 – 1,500,000 |
| Domestic Pump | CRI | 0.5 HP | 350,000 – 600,000 |
| Solar Submersible Pump | Lorentz | 2 HP | 2,500,000 – 5,000,000 |
Performance Curves and Datasheet Example
When buying Submersible Water Pumps in Tanzania, it is good to check the performance curve. The curve shows how much water the pump can lift at different depths.
Sample Performance Data (for a 1.5 HP Borehole Pump):
| Depth (Meters) | Flow Rate (Liters/Hour) |
|---|---|
| 20m | 12,000 L/h |
| 40m | 10,000 L/h |
| 60m | 8,000 L/h |
| 80m | 6,500 L/h |
| 100m | 5,000 L/h |
This kind of datasheet helps farmers and homeowners know if the pump can meet their needs.
